Delist Key Cryptocurrencies on September 18, 2024

Essential Steps and What You Need to Know:

On September 18, 2024, Binance will be removing several cryptocurrencies from its platform as part of its routine evaluation process.

Hereโ€™s what you need to know about the delisting and how to prepare:

Cryptocurrencies Scheduled for Delisting:

ForTube ($FOR): Currently at 0.00997 USDT, FOR has plummeted -42.51% in the last 24 hours. Its delisting is due to poor market performance.

Ellipsis ($EPX): Trading at 0.0000799 USDT, EPX has dropped -34.60%. The decision is based on reduced user engagement.

Voyager Token (VGX): At 0.0399 USDT, VGX has fallen -33.64% amid the collapse of the Voyager platform.

PowerPool ($CVP): With a current price of 0.2300 USDT, CVP has decreased -39.23%, reflecting declining interest in its governance protocol.

Reef ($REEF): Priced at 0.000917 USDT, REEF has seen a -21.08% drop, prompting its removal due to challenges in bridging DeFi and centralized exchanges.

Actions to Take:

Withdraw or Convert Holdings: Transfer or exchange your assets before the delisting date to avoid potential losses.

Transfer to Supported Wallets:

Move your holdings to an external wallet that supports these tokens if you wish to retain them.

Stay Updated:

Monitor Binance for further updates on the delisting timeline and potential impacts.

Explore Other Platforms: Consider other exchanges that may continue to support these tokens if you want to keep trading them.

Reasons for Delisting: Binanceโ€™s decision is influenced by factors such as low trading volumes, reduced user interest, lack of development, and market sustainability concerns.
